#385973 Hex Color Code

#385973

The Hexadecimal Color #385973 is a contrast shade of Dark Slate Gray. #385973 RGB value is rgb(56, 89, 115). RGB Color Model of #385973 consists of 21% red, 34% green and 45% blue. HSL color Mode of #385973 has 206°(degrees) Hue, 35% Saturation and 34% Lightness. #385973 color has an wavelength of 490.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#385973 is #666699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#385973 is #357. The Closest Color to #385973 is #2F4F4F. Official Name of #385973 Hex Code is San Juan.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#385973 is 51 Cyan 23 Magenta 0 Yellow 55 Black and #385973 CMY is 51, 23,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#385973 is hsl(206,35,34,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(206, 51, 45).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#385973 is 8.3, 9.22, 17.56.
Hex8 Value of #385973 is #385973FF. Decimal Value of #385973 is 3692915 and Octal Value of #385973 is 16054563. Binary Value of #385973 is 111000, 1011001, 1110011 and Android of #385973 is 4281882995 / 0xff385973.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#385973 is 0.237, 0.263, 0.263 and YIQ Color Space of #385973 is 82.097, -28.0185, 1.1117.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#385973 is 7.19, 9.92, 17.42.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#385973 is 36.4, -4.05, -18.51.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#385973 is 36.4, -14.78, -24.59.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#385973 is 36.4, 18.95, 257.66. Hunter Lab variable of #385973 is 30.36, -4.35, -13.03.

Various Color Shades of #385973

To get 25% Saturated #385973 Color, you need to convert the hex color #385973 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#385973 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#385973

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
